Now, news has broke that says Chloe Grace Moretz will star in a new movie from Project Power and The Batman scribe Mattson Tomlin. According to the Hollywood Reporter, Moretz will star in Tomlin's first directorial effort with Reeves' production banner providing support for the feature. 

The movie, Mother/Android is said to be about a couple that's on the run from their country that's at war with artificial intelligence. Days before their first child is born, they must face their own mortality in a no man's land where the android's have set up their stronghold. Moretz will be the lead character Georgia who sets off with her partner Sam, who is yet to be cast. 


The feature is set to be released by Miramax with no official release date announced quite yet.
